Lyndon Manalo

 

I was born and raised in the Philippines. I came here in the U.S. in 1990. In 2001, I graduated with a degree in Fine Arts, major in Computer Arts, at the Academy of Arts University in San Francisco.

I collect Japanese woodblock prints which is the inspiration behind my artworks. I take pictures with my camera and then edit them in my computer using Photoshop.

When I make art, I put much of myself into the piece; my camera is my paint brush and the world is my canvas! My art is a reflection of my internal state. The thought process of every art piece that I create always includes the background and the people in it. My subject matter is the nature around me; the bright sunshine, the blue skies, the majestic mountains, the beautiful ocean, the green trees, etc.

My goal is to inspire others with my artwork and I want them to see the beauty of the world in the way I express myself as an artist. My artworks are often defined by vibrant colors which creates a sense of freedom and If I can move another person and lift their spirit with it, I can definitely say that my purpose as an artist is accomplished!
